متن کاملThe PRESTO technique for fMRI
In the early days of BOLD fMRI, the acquisition of T(2)(*) weighted data was greatly facilitated by rapid scan techniques such as EPI. The latter, however, was only available on a few MRI systems that were equipped with specialized hardware that allowed rapid switching of the imaging gradients. متن کاملAssociation of NEDD9 with TGF-β-triggered epithelialmesenchymal transition and cell invasion in prostate cancer cells: implications for cancer aggressiveness
NEDD9 belongs to the Cas (Crk-associated substrate) family, proteins of which mediate downstream signaling processes including cell-cycle, tumorigenesis and cytoskeletal organization. In epithelial-mesenchymal transition (EMT), NEDD9 plays an important role, but the functional mechanism underlying NEDD9-mediated EMT in prostate cancer (PCa) remains uncertain.
